cityprofessionalParticipantCorrection, MorleyJS
*SOME* QR passengers get to use the Virgin lounge. IIRC, it is only First Class pax or Gold card holders on selected flights. Otherwise you have to make do with the Servisair lounge, which is pretty cruddy
In many ways QR is as market leading as the other Gulf mega-carriers, but in terms of ground services, the lack of a limo and decent lounge facilities outside of its hub airport puts it well behind Emirates and Etihad

PotakasParticipantBack on topic, here is a link with future terminal moves.
Air Mauritius 24 November 2010 from Terminal 3 to Terminal 4
Qatar Airways 8 December 2010 Terminal 3 to Terminal 4
Saudi Arabian Airlines TBC Terminal 3 to Terminal 4
Although United Airlines and Continental Airlines are merging, this doesn’t affect the terminals they use at Heathrow. United flights still go to Terminal 1, and Continental to Terminal 4.
